31 #include "defs.h"
32 #include <asm/ioctl.h>
33
34 static int
35 compare(const void *a, const void *b)
36 {
37         unsigned long code1 = (long) a;
38         unsigned long code2 = ((struct_ioctlent *) b)->code;
39         return (code1 > code2) ? 1 : (code1 < code2) ? -1 : 0;
40 }
41
42 const struct_ioctlent *
43 ioctl_lookup(long code)
44 {
45         struct_ioctlent *iop;
46
47         code &= (_IOC_NRMASK<<_IOC_NRSHIFT) | (_IOC_TYPEMASK<<_IOC_TYPESHIFT);
48         iop = bsearch((void*)code, ioctlent,
49                         nioctlents, sizeof(ioctlent[0]), compare);
50         while (iop > ioctlent) {
51                 iop--;
52                 if (iop->code != code) {
53                         iop++;
54                         break;
55                 }
56         }
57         return iop;
58 }
59
60 const struct_ioctlent *
61 ioctl_next_match(const struct_ioctlent *iop)
62 {
63         long code;
64
65         code = iop->code;
66         iop++;
67         if (iop < ioctlent + nioctlents && iop->code == code)
68                 return iop;
69         return NULL;
70 }
71
72 int
73 ioctl_decode(struct tcb *tcp, long code, long arg)
74 {
75         switch ((code >> 8) & 0xff) {
76 #if defined(ALPHA) || defined(POWERPC)
77         case 'f': case 't': case 'T':
78 #else /* !ALPHA */
79         case 0x54:
80 #endif /* !ALPHA */
81                 return term_ioctl(tcp, code, arg);
82         case 0x89:
83                 return sock_ioctl(tcp, code, arg);
84         case 'p':
85                 return rtc_ioctl(tcp, code, arg);
86         case 0x03:
87         case 0x12:
88                 return block_ioctl(tcp, code, arg);
89         case 0x22:
90                 return scsi_ioctl(tcp, code, arg);
91         case 'L':
92                 return loop_ioctl(tcp, code, arg);
93         case 'M':
94                 return mtd_ioctl(tcp, code, arg);
95         default:
96                 break;
97         }
98         return 0;
99 }
